The Evolution of Crypto Casinos and Blockchain Technology
The integration of blockchain technology into online casinos isn’t simply about accepting cryptocurrencies as payment methods; it’s about fundamentally altering the architecture of these platforms. Traditional casinos, while often legitimate, operate under a degree of opacity. Players must trust that the casino is operating fairly, and that the random number generators (RNGs) used in games are truly random. Blockchain technology offers a solution to this trust issue by enabling provably fair gaming. Provably fair systems utilize cryptographic algorithms to allow players to verify the fairness of each game round independently. This transparency is a significant departure from the traditional model and a core selling point for many crypto casinos.
Furthermore, the decentralized nature of blockchain minimizes the need for intermediaries, reducing operational costs for casinos and potentially leading to higher payout percentages for players. Smart contracts, self-executing agreements written into the blockchain, can automate payouts and ensure that winnings are distributed promptly and securely. This automation also reduces the risk of human error or manipulation. Scalability and Transaction Fees: Ongoing Challenges
While the benefits of blockchain technology are substantial, several challenges remain. Scalability is a primary concern, as many blockchains currently struggle to handle the high volume of transactions required for a fully functional online casino. Transaction fees can also be prohibitively high during periods of network congestion, negating some of the cost-saving benefits of using cryptocurrency. Layer-2 scaling solutions, such as Lightning Network and sidechains, are being developed to address these issues, aiming to increase transaction throughput and reduce fees. These solutions operate on top of the main blockchain, processing transactions off-chain and then settling them on the main chain periodically.
The success of these solutions will be crucial for the mainstream adoption of blockchain-based casinos. Despite the existing problems, consistent improvements are steadily improving the speed and reducing the cost of blockchain transactions. As the technology matures, it’s expected to become increasingly viable for high-volume applications like online gaming.

Regulatory Landscape and Licensing Challenges
The regulatory landscape surrounding crypto casinos is still evolving, and navigating the legal complexities can be challenging. Many jurisdictions are grappling with how to classify and regulate cryptocurrencies, and the application of existing gambling laws to crypto casinos is often unclear. Obtaining a gambling license can be particularly difficult for crypto casinos, as regulators may be hesitant to authorize platforms that operate with decentralized technologies. This lack of regulatory clarity creates uncertainty for both operators and players.
Some jurisdictions, such as Curacao and Malta, have adopted more progressive approaches to regulating crypto casinos, offering specialized licenses tailored to this emerging industry. However, the requirements for obtaining these licenses can still be stringent, and ongoing compliance can be costly. As the industry matures, it’s expected that more comprehensive regulatory frameworks will emerge, providing greater clarity and stability. Until then, players should carefully research the licensing status and reputation of any crypto casino before depositing funds or engaging in gameplay.
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Compliance
Despite the emphasis on decentralization and privacy, crypto casinos are still subject to KYC and AML regulations. These regulations are designed to prevent money laundering, terrorist financing, and other illicit activities. Crypto casinos are typically required to verify the identity of their players and monitor transactions for suspicious activity. This can involve collecting personal information, such as name, address, and date of birth.
The implementation of KYC and AML procedures can be a delicate balancing act, as it can compromise the privacy that many crypto users value. However, compliance with these regulations is essential for maintaining a legitimate and sustainable operation. Advanced KYC solutions, utilizing biometric verification and blockchain analytics, are being developed to streamline the process and minimize the intrusion on user privacy.
